Remove border css
Hello! I used to remove border css when convert from fb2 to azw3. I only had to put "border" in look&feel/extra css. But this doesn't work in the last version 1.12.
I would like to know how I can do that now. Thanks in advance. Sorry for my bad English. |

I think you would have more success putting border in Look&Feel - Filter Style info - Other CSS properties if you are trying to remove css. The Extra CSS option adds CSS rather than removes it.

You need to put in all the possible border properties, namely:
border-top-color border-top-style border-top-width and so on for bottom, right, and left |

But I have a question: I think it was easier to do this before 1.4 version, I only put "border" in "Other css properties" and borders were removed. Now I have to put top, bottom, right, left, and color, style, width. Why is more difficult now? |

Previously it only worked because the book you were converting happened to use the shorthand form, if it did not it would not have worked. Now all css shorthand properties are expanded internally during conversion, this is necessary to avoid a few CSS cascading bugs.
Therefore, it is now necessary to specify the full properties to be removed explicitly. I might add a feature in the next release to automatically expand shorthand css properties specified in the filter css box, so that one does not have to enter them manually. |
